广州鼎峰网络信息科技有限公司
主营产品: 软件开发 系统开发 APP搭建 系统源码
看广告短剧app系统软件开发 源码搭建

开发一个看广告短剧APP系统,并进行源码搭建,是一个复杂但具有挑战性的项目。以下是一个详细的开发指南,涵盖了从市场调研到上线发布的全过程:

一、明确目标与需求

确定目标用户群体:了解目标用户的年龄、性别、兴趣爱好等,以便为他们提供定制化的内容和服务。

分析功能需求:明确APP的核心功能,如短剧播放、广告展示、用户系统、奖励机制等。

二、市场调研与竞品分析

调研市场需求:了解当前市场上类似APP的优缺点,分析用户需求和行业趋势。

分析竞品:研究竞争对手的产品特点、用户反馈和市场份额,以便找到自己的差异化竞争优势。

三、技术选型与架构设计

前端技术:选择适合移动应用开发的前端框架,如React Native、Flutter或原生开发(iOS的Swift/Objective-C,Android的Java/Kotlin)。这些框架能够提供丰富的UI组件和快速的开发周期。

后端技术:根据需求选择合适的后端技术栈,如Node.js、Java、Python等。并设计合理的后端架构,确保系统的稳定性和可扩展性。

数据库系统:选择合适的数据库系统,如MySQL、MongoDB等,用于存储用户数据、短剧内容、广告记录等信息。

四、功能开发与实现

用户系统:开发用户注册、登录、个人信息管理等功能,确保用户数据的安全性和隐私性。

短剧内容系统:实现短剧内容的上传、审核、发布、播放等功能。支持多种视频格式和清晰度,确保流畅的用户体验。

广告系统:集成广告平台的SDK(如Google AdMob、UnityAds等),实现广告的加载、展示、播放、关闭以及奖励验证等功能。确保广告内容的相关性和吸引力,同时避免过度干扰用户体验。

奖励机制:设计观看广告赚取奖励的机制,如积分、优惠券、免费观看时长等。增强用户参与度和应用商业价值。

数据分析与优化:添加数据分析工具,收集用户的行为数据和广告效果数据。根据数据分析结果,优化APP的功能和广告展示策略。

五、测试与优化

单元测试:对各个模块进行单元测试,确保代码的正确性和稳定性。

集成测试:将各个模块集成在一起进行测试,确保系统整体功能的正常运行。

用户测试:邀请目标用户群体进行测试,收集反馈意见并对系统进行优化和改进。

六、部署与上线

部署准备:将开发完成的APP部署到服务器,并进行终的测试。

上线发布:将APP提交到各大应用商店进行审核和发布。确保APP符合相关平台的政策和规定。

七、后期运营与推广

用户运营:开展用户活动,提高用户的活跃度和忠诚度。

内容运营:定期更新短剧内容,保持用户的新鲜感。

广告合作:与广告商合作,提供的广告投放服务,实现商业变现。

数据分析:利用数据分析工具持续追踪用户行为,分析广告效果,为优化运营策略提供依据。

八、法律合规与安全性

遵守法律法规:确保APP的开发和运营符合相关法律法规和平台政策,避免违规操作导致的风险。

保护用户隐私:加强APP系统的安全性建设,保护用户的隐私和信息安全。采用先进的加密技术和安全防护措施,防止黑客攻击和数据泄露等风险事件的发生。

综上所述,开发一个看广告短剧APP系统并进行源码搭建需要综合考虑多个方面,包括市场调研、技术选型、功能开发、测试优化、部署上线以及后期运营与推广等。通过精心策划和严格执行这些步骤,可以成功打造出一个既满足用户需求又具有商业价值的APP产品。


展开全文
拨打电话 微信咨询 发送询价